"...Freedom Songs..."

For a group with such staggering longevity, fame and beloved status amongst fans, contemporaries and everyone else in and outside of the music business for that matter - THE STAPLE SINGERS have had gapping CD sinkholes in their voluminous catalogue that have remained stubbornly unplugged. Until now that is...

The first part of their career proper on Riverside Records USA is roughly covered by the 4CD set "Four Classic Albums Plus Singles" issued 2016 on Real Gone Music RGMCD214 (Barcode 5036408180728) giving fans four full albums between 1961 and 1964 along with many non-album 45s. Their more famous Stax Records Soul and Funk period between 1968 and 1975 has had individual album releases galore as well as two whole remastered CDs devoted to it on the gorgeous-sounding "Faith & Grace" 4CD Book Set issued in 2015 (that beautiful looking book set came complete with a repro 7” single attached to the front and covered a wide range of output from 1953 to 1976 – see separate review). Which brings us to this - the fermenting-their-sound spaces in-between...

Issued by SoulMusic Records of the UK (a label imprint for the mucho respected Cherry Red) and offering up a huge six albums worth and more of Gospel, R&B and Soul across 3CDs – the 65-songs of 2018's "For What It's Worth..." gives three of their period LP platters their digital debut - "Pray On" (1965), "For What It's Worth" (1967) and "What The World Needs Now Is Love" (1968). There is also an airing for their only non-album B-side from the period "Power Of Love" - a flip to their thematically fitting cover of The Youngbloods everybody-love-each-other hit "Let's Get Together" in 1968 on Epic 5-10294. In short – this is a Staple fan's Christmas Cracker and I for one am so glad it's finally been realised. Here are the messages of love...

UK released Friday, 12 October 2018 (19 Oct 2018 in the USA) - "For What It's Worth: The Complete Epic Recordings 1964-1968" by THE STAPLE SINGERS on SoulMusic Records SMCR51758X (Barcode 5013929087507) offers six albums and one 7" single B-side (65 Tracks all in Mono except Tracks 11 to 21 on Disc 3) Remastered across 3CDs and plays out as follows:

The clamshell-box houses three singular card sleeves, the artwork to two albums on each with the discography details for both on the rear. A 16-page booklet with new BOB FISHER liner notes gives an excellent and in-depth history of the Staples transition period from all-out Gospel holy-rollers down at the local Baptist Church to Folk Revival festival faves singing Bob Dylan covers and Freedom Songs in a Soul and R&B way. There is even Blues here with Pops trademark warbling guitar and the SIMON MURPHY Remasters are excellent.


A joyful listen I never thought I'd ever hear – lovers of Gospel, Soul, Righteous R 'n' B and Right On Funk will find many goodies here to discover and enjoy. Dig in and spread the word I say…and well done to all at Soul Music for a top job done…
